I refilled my Equate antacid equivalent to Gaviscon which I have been using for years. The new tablets which have an imprint of G 128 are nothing like they have been. They are now somewhat gritty and have a mint flavor. The former tabs have little taste but for a slight sweetness. They are not gritty and evolve into almost a gel when chewed.

Did you ask the Wal-Mart pharmacist about this?

They may have changed the formulation of the Equate product.


https:/­/­rxchat.com/­wiki/­Gaviscon/­

It is considered an over the counter product, which doesn't require a prescription, so they are really free to change some stuff about it, whenever they choose to do so.
